Output b44e90a18976fc65a9779cd683d2917c0b6d2d66f353ec99e38707c15458c20a:54

value
673055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96111ffb562a95f4a744d3bc8cc3dbed587c920 OP_EQUAL
address
3L3p2fX1vh42pN57p41iXQ4CBLq65Sx5si
transaction
b44e90a18976fc65a9779cd683d2917c0b6d2d66f353ec99e38707c15458c20a
confirmations
255523
spent
true